The Plight of Hindu Widows
Hindu widows are among the most marginalized and vulnerable people in India. They are often treated as outcasts, and they face discrimination in all aspects of their lives. They are often denied basic rights, such as the right to remarry or to inherit property. They are also often subjected to violence and abuse.
The plight of Hindu widows is a serious human rights issue. It is a violation of their basic rights and freedoms. It is also a form of violence against women.
